On September 14, Hurricane Ike arrived in the Evansville
area. German Township Fire Department was pretty lucky until 10:23 when there
first "investigation wires down.." dispatch hit. After the second alarm the duty
officer for that day Captain Craig became a manager of equipment, acknowledging
the dispatches and sending crews to the scenes. Ther were 14 runs during this
time.
One of the more interesting runs was on New Harmnoy Rd, where a transformer had
exploded and the oil leaked around the pole. A spark set it on fire and
threatened to burn the pole. The crew got water on it and stopped the fire from
spreading. Just as they relaxed, the transformer on the pole behind the engine exploded with a large
bang. Needless to say, they all ducked!!
